  • Title

    Performance evaluation of public access mobile radio (PAMR) systems with priority calls

  • Abstract
    This paper presents a procedure for estimating the mean access delay of calls in public access mobile radio (PAMR) trunking systems. For this purpose, an approximation of the mean waiting time in the M/G/C queue with non-preemptive priority is developed and numerically tested. The proposed approximation is based on other existing approximations and has been tested for the conditions commonly found in PAMR systems with very accurate results
